International football star to host Sheffield business mentoring event

Entrepreneurs and business owners based throughout the Sheffield City Region are set to be put through their paces by a former England international football player who swapped the boot room for the boardroom at a free event in October.

In a professional football career which spanned more than fourteen years, Danny Mills was one of the most formidable defenders of his generation, winning the League Cup with Middlesbrough, earning 19 caps for his country as well as representing four Premier League clubs including Leeds United and Manchester City.

Outside of football, the former right back has built and maintained a commercial and residential property portfolio and following his retirement from the game, Danny has continued to develop his business interests, successfully turning around the West Cornwall Pasty Co and sold Deeside print from Excelsior Technologies for £33m earlier this year.

Danny will speak at a special event hosted by Launchpad Mentoring; a Sheffield City Region wide programme which matches new entrepreneurs with experienced business owners. The event is designed to encourage business owners to pledge their support and sign up to become a Launchpad mentor, to pass their skills and knowledge to new entrepreneurs to help them achieve their full potential.


During his talk, Danny will share the story of his dramatic change of direction from football to business as well as providing tips and tools to promote business growth and explaining how the role of mentors has helped to shape his own business journey.

The event forms part of Launchpad Mentoring Month which takes place during October and is just one of a series of workshops and activities which will celebrate and showcase the role mentoring can play in helping business owners to succeed.

Throughout the night there will be the chance for attendees to network and create business contacts and hear from some of the businesses that have benefitted from mentoring support through the Launchpad programme, as well as enjoying refreshments and live music from Anastasia Walker of Doncaster band Bang Bang Romeo. Danny Mills said:
“I have always had an interest in business and alongside my football career I created a successful commercial and residential property portfolio. After retiring from professional football I wanted to put my business skills and knowledge to further use and joined forces with the partners at Private Equity Turnaround Specialist Endless LLP to form Enact, creating an investment fund aimed at helping distressed SME businesses get back to success.
